Answer 3

Given:-

1. Length of ship = 200m


2. Breath of ship = 20m
3. Cw = 0.8
4. RD of water = 1.015

20m
Cw = 0.8

200m

TPC at FW = L * B * Cw * RDFW
100

TPC at FW = 200 * 20 * 0.8 * 1


100

TPC at FW = 32t/cm

TPC at DW = L * B * Cw * RDDW
100

TPC at DW = 200 * 20 * 0.8 * 1.015


100

TPC at DW = 32.48t/cm

TPC at SW = L * B * Cw * RDSW
100

TPC at SW = 200 * 20 * 0.8 * 1.025


100

TPC at SW = 32.8t/cm

1. TPC at FW is 32t/cm
2. TPC at DW is 32.48t/cm
3. TPC at SW is 32.8t/cm

Answer 4

Given:-

1. Dimensions of tank = 20m * 10.5m * 1m


2. Block coefficient (CB) = 0.82
3. RD of fuel oil = 0.95

1m

10.5 m

CB = 0.82

20 m

Volume of tank = L * B * H *CB

Volume of tank = 20 * 10.5 * 1 * 0.82

Volume of tank = 172.2 m3

RD fuel oil = Mass of fuel oil


Volume of tank

0.95 = Mass of fuel oil


172.2

163.6t = Mass of fuel oil

Double bottom tank can hold 163.6t of fuel oil
